| Summary | The world's most frequently flown orbital rocket. Block 5 first stages have landed over 280 times and reflown up to 23 times. Backbone of Starlink and commercial crewed launches. | Rocket Lab's medium-lift reusable rocket targeting the $100B constellation replenishment market. Uses a 'hungry hippo' fairings design that opens at the top rather than traditional clamshell separation. First flight delayed to Q4 2026 after a Jan 2026 propellant tank test anomaly. | The world's most commercially active small launch vehicle, designed and built in-house at Rocket Lab. Rutherford engines are the first flight-proven engines made with additive manufacturing (metal 3D printing). Booster recovery via parachute and helicopter catch (later transitioned to ocean recovery). |
